Division of Undergraduate Education:Advanced Technological Education (ATE)
• Emphasis on two-year colleges• Partnerships between academic institutions
and employers to promote improvement in the education of science and engineering technicians at the undergraduate and secondary school levels

Energy and USDA Award $25 Million
• Joint Biomass Research and Development Initiative
• Funds will be used for biomass research, development and demonstration projects
CFDA Number 81.087

EPA
National Center for Environmental Innovation (NCEI)
• Enable information exchange and learning by State and EPA employees that are interested in new approaches for achieving environmental results
• Identify and highlight environmental innovations that can help States learn about new ways to achieve environmental results
